One-Pot Cajun Sausage and Rice

A quick, low effort meal that requires only one pan and minimal prep

Prep Time: 5 minutes
Cook Time: 25 minutes
Total Time: 30 minutes
Servings: 4

Equipment

  • 1 saucepan deep skillet, saucepan, or dutch oven with lid

Ingredients

  • 8 ounce box Zatarain's Jambalaya Rice Mix (reduced sodium)
  • 1 pound Andouille Chicken Sausage or any smoked sausage
  • 26.5 ounce jar marinara sauce
  • 14.5 ounce can Rotel's diced tomatoes or any diced tomatoes
  • 1 cup water

Instructions

  • Cut sausage into 1/2" rounds
  • Mix all ingredients together in a large, deep skillet on medium to medium-high heat
  • Bring to a boil
  • Cover, reduce temperature to low, and simmer for about 20 minutes until rice is tender. Add more water if needed.

Notes

This recipe is kind of spicy.  If you don't like spicy, use smoked sausage and regular diced tomatoes instead of the Rotel's.
I like Hunt's Traditional Spaghetti sauce in this recipe
